Mexico Telehealth Market Size, Share, Trends and Forecast by Component, Communication Technology, Hosting Type, Application, End-User, and Region, 2026-2034
The Mexico telehealth market size was valued at USD 406.9 Million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 1.93 billion by 2034, growing at a compound annual growth rate of 18.22% from 2026-2034. The rising internet penetration, increasing smartphone usage, government initiatives to expand digital healthcare access, a growing aging population, rising chronic disease prevalence, and healthcare provider shortages in rural regions are increasing the demand for remote consultations, thereby propelling the market expansion in Mexico.
Mexico Telehealth Market Trends:
Expansion of Digital Infrastructure and Mobile Connectivity
Mexico is witnessing substantial investments in digital infrastructure, facilitating broader access to telehealth services, which is augmenting Mexico telehealth market share. The expansion of 4G and rollout of 5G networks in metropolitan areas, along with initiatives to improve internet connectivity in rural and semi-urban regions, is creating a stable foundation for virtual healthcare delivery. According to industry reports, nearly 80% of the population in Mexico had internet access as of 2023. This widespread connectivity is enabling a larger share of the population to access remote consultations via smartphones and tablets. This digital growth is also prompting the development of dedicated telemedicine platforms with features such as secure video consultations, electronic health records (EHRs), and real-time monitoring. Urban centers like Mexico City, Guadalajara, and Monterrey are leading in user adoption, but efforts are ongoing to bridge the digital divide in underserved areas through public-private partnerships and subsidized internet programs. Furthermore, increased smartphone adoption among older demographics and lower-income groups is enabling telehealth platforms to target a wider consumer base, driving inclusivity in digital healthcare services.
Increased Demand from Chronic Disease Management and Aging Population
Mexico’s rising burden of chronic diseases, such as diabetes, cardiovascular conditions, and hypertension, is significantly influencing the Mexico telehealth market growth. The country has one of the highest diabetes prevalence rates among OECD nations, placing immense pressure on its healthcare infrastructure. Telehealth solutions offer a practical way to monitor patients remotely, adjust treatment regimens, and provide continuous education and behavioral counseling without frequent hospital visits. This demand is further amplified by Mexico’s aging population, projected to account for over 20.2% of the total population by 2050. Older adults often require ongoing management for multiple health conditions, and telemedicine enables cost-effective, home-based care that reduces the need for travel and mitigates the risk of hospital-acquired infections. Wearable health devices and remote patient monitoring tools are gaining traction, particularly in urban households with elderly members. Moreover, family caregivers are becoming active stakeholders in virtual consultations, improving treatment adherence and outcome tracking. The convergence of these demographic and health trends is creating sustained, long-term demand for telehealth services across Mexico.
The Mexican government is implementing multiple regulatory reforms to promote the integration of telehealth services into mainstream healthcare delivery. For instance, on January 13, 2025, Mexico's Ministry of Health announced the integration of public and expert input into the National Development Plan (PND) 2025-2030, emphasizing health initiatives such as mental health support and technological advancements to enhance healthcare access. A key focus is the implementation of telemedicine to improve care accessibility, particularly for individuals in remote areas, by reducing travel needs and minimizing daily life disruptions. Further, the regulatory support extends to data protection, as telehealth providers must comply with Mexico’s Federal Law on Protection of Personal Data Held by Private Parties, ensuring patient confidentiality. The government has also allowed remote prescriptions for certain categories of medication, improving treatment continuity for chronic illness patients. Additionally, the integration of telehealth into public health insurance schemes, such as IMSS and ISSSTE, is gradually being explored, which could significantly widen service reach. These regulatory moves have reduced institutional resistance, encouraged hospital investment in telemedicine tools, and enhances the Mexico telehealth market outlook.
